Transaction f66d02ccd3faae3bbb3361765f4620c4f3be3e6fd1f5a04dbbf276e747a750e7
2 Input
2 Outputs
- f66d02ccd3faae3bbb3361765f4620c4f3be3e6fd1f5a04dbbf276e747a750e7:0
- f66d02ccd3faae3bbb3361765f4620c4f3be3e6fd1f5a04dbbf276e747a750e7:1
value 653221
address 15HauaZEeAnuJCam91WZGgNX1TTZofctVU
value 3465647
address 1BbdSS7g17hds4gyqJczeVxPCwyAw99jeh